Single-Operator Stress Ultrasound Evaluation of Ulnohumeral Joint Instability Related to Medial Ulnar Collateral Ligament Injury: The Mayo Technique
Listen to this summary
The authors aim to introduce and describe a novel single-operator stress ultrasound technique for evaluating the integrity of the medial ulnar collateral ligament (MUCL) by measuring ulnohumeral joint widening under valgus stress. This method seeks to improve clinical efficiency and patient comfort compared to traditional dual-operator techniques. The paper highlights the need for further research to assess the clinical feasibility and reliability of this approach in musculoskeletal ultrasound practice.
